No Time to Say Goodbye

We didn’t have time to say goodbye,

One moment you were here, laughing and breathing,

Your presence so solid beside me.

Then suddenly you weren’t.

You were cruelly snatched from me,

Like a page torn from a book, mid chapter,

Like a light switched off without warning,

Plunging me into darkness and despair.

I wanted to say thank you, but was denied that chance,

Thank you for your love,

Unassuming, unwavering but passionate,

The kind of love that made the world feel safe.

Thank you for your support.

The way you stood behind me,

Especially when I doubted myself,

Even when the rest of the world looked away,

You were there for me.

Thank you for your loyalty and fidelity,

Not just the promises, but the small things you never thought I noticed,

The way you gently spoke about us,

The way you believed in us,

The way that you held our happiness in your hands and in your heart,

Like it was the most precious of treasures.

I am so sorry that I didn’t say those things.

I thought we had more time.

Now there is only silence and coldness,

With the ache of all I never said haunting me.

But know this,

You were my everything,

And I carry you in everything I do.

For eternity.
